    My car has the bose speaker system, and i bought a Sony XPLOD cd player. (not until after i bought it did i hear how much that line sucked) The HU is using the bose sub as a full range speaker. All the treble is coming out of it just as the door speakers, and it just fades in and out with the greater bass. I suppose that's because the bose sub has no crossover. My HU has a subwoofer out, but the stock wiring doesn't give me much idea as to how i would hook it up to get the sub to the sub out. Also, when i unplugg the sub, my rear speakers turn off, so i was wondering it those speakers maybe ran off the subwoofer's amp. if so, the whole sub out idea probably wouldn't be the smartest without some major rewiring. any suggestions?

    You cannot just pull the Bose HU & put in a new unit.
    You have to get an adapter to make it work.
    This is all due to the Bose speakers that have built in amps.

    I bought a used 94 Camaro with the Bose speaker system & with a new Kenwood HU.
    It turns out you have to get a wireing adapter for everything to work right.

    If i'm on the same page you are, go to crutchfield.com go to "what fits my car", make sure you put in you have a bose system, it wll tell you about the converter from Bose to regular HU. Hope this makes sence, good luck.
